Tourism without barriers

Available translations:

Genoa takes great care of disabled tourists.

Public and private entities have cooperated in drawing up guides, databases and dedicated sites providing exhaustive and useful information to help disabled people visit Genoa and various interesting areas around it as easily as possible.

terre di mare, information for disabled peopleThe service offered by Genoa Provincial Department for Social Policies allows people who have difficulties in walking to rent four-wheel electrical scooters in order to easily visit the old town and all accessible tourist facilities in Genoa.

Renting the scooter is free for all people holding the card "OK Liguria per tutti" (OK Liguria for all), which can be obtained contacting the service centre “Terre di Mare” or completing the dedicated form available on-line. This service is managed by the operators of social cooperative La Cruna and made possible thanks to Costa Edutainment S.p.a.’s sponsorship.

It offers information on disabled access for tourist services (hotels, restaurants, cinema, theatres…), a map of tourist routes which are free of architectural barriers, information on accompanying services, assistance and tourist guides.

Genoa for allMoreover, the guide "Genova per tutti noi" (Genoa for all of us) is also available, which allows tourists having motor disabilities to discover the city independently and to enjoy an accurate and reliable source of information on the accessibility of specific itineraries and accommodation facilities.

The identification of accessible tourist itineraries was the outcome of a far-reaching study aimed at monitoring the accessibility of pedestrian itineraries, carried out by La Cruna by order of Genoa City Department for Equal Opportunities, with the cooperation of Consulta Handicap. The same professional operators also analysed existing architectural barriers in approximately 500 different facilities, from museums to cinemas, from theatres to hotels, from restaurants to shops.

The Italian or French or English version of the guide can be easily downloaded from Social Cooperative La Cruna’s official site.

Disable people can also request a copy of the Italian version of the guide “Genova per tutti noi” by completing the relevant form on La Cruna’s site or calling the centre “Terre di Mare” at Tel. +39 010.542098.
